COLUMBUS – The Columbus Crew have signed midfielder Tristan Brown as a Homegrown Player through the 2028 season with Club options for 2029 and 2030. The 17-year-old Crew Academy product is the second-youngest player to sign a Homegrown contract with Columbus (Ben Swanson in 2015) and 24th overall.

On March 22, Brown became the second-youngest player (17 years, five months and three days) in Crew history to make his MLS debut with the First Team when he entered in the 73rd minute and helped preserve the shutout in a 0-0 draw against NYCFC. He made his second MLS appearance as an 80th-minute substitute during the 1-1 road draw at CF Montreal on May 14.
This year, Brown has started all seven MLS NEXT Pro matches played, tallying two assists. He also started all three of Crew 2’s Lamar Hunt U.S. Open Cup matches and notched a goal in the 4-1 win over the New York Renegades in First Round action.
Brown started with the Crew Academy in August 2022 at the Under-15 level after spending time with the Michigan Wolves, a Crew Network club. He ultimately joined Crew 2 on an amateur agreement at the start of the 2024 season before signing an MLS NEXT Pro contract in August. In 2024, Brown appeared in 20 matches (16 starts), helping Crew 2 reach their third consecutive Eastern Conference Final. For his efforts, Brown was selected to participate in the MLS NEXT All-Star Game hosted at Historic Crew Stadium as part of the week-long All-Star festivities in Columbus.
In 2023, Brown contributed in two Crew 2 matches, including his first start (71 minutes) during a 4-0 win in the Heck is Plausible match against FC Cincinnati 2 on Sept. 17.
The Novi, Mich., native has participated in two U-17 USYNT camps: October 2023 in Portland, Ore. and March 2024 in West Palm Beach, Fla.
Brown joins Taha Habroune, Stanislav Lapkes, Cole Mrowka and Sean Zawadzki as the five Crew Academy players on the current roster.
